The Importance Of Emergency Fire Telephones

In any emergency situation, quick and effective communication can make all the difference. This is especially true in the case of fires, where every second counts. One important tool that can aid in communication during a fire emergency is the emergency fire telephone. These specially designed phones are strategically placed in buildings to provide a direct line of communication to firefighting personnel in the event of a fire. In this article, we will discuss the importance of emergency fire telephones and the role they play in ensuring the safety of building occupants.

One of the most critical aspects of fire safety is the ability to quickly alert emergency services in the event of a fire. Traditional methods of communication, such as cell phones or landlines, are not always reliable during emergencies. Cell phone reception may be poor inside buildings, and landlines can be damaged or inaccessible during a fire. emergency fire telephones provide a dedicated and reliable means of communication that is specifically designed for use during a fire emergency.

emergency fire telephones are typically located in stairwells, hallways, or other common areas of buildings where they can be easily accessed by occupants. These phones are often equipped with features such as a bright red color, flashing lights, and clear signage to make them easily identifiable during an emergency. In addition, emergency fire telephones are typically powered by the building’s emergency backup system, ensuring that they remain operational even in the event of a power outage.

When a fire breaks out, time is of the essence. The ability to quickly inform firefighting personnel of the location and severity of the fire can help them respond more effectively and potentially save lives. emergency fire telephones provide a direct line of communication to the building’s fire alarm monitoring system or directly to the local fire department. This allows building occupants to quickly report a fire without having to search for a working phone or wait on hold for emergency services.

In addition to providing a direct line of communication during a fire emergency, emergency fire telephones can also serve as a valuable tool for building management and emergency response teams. Many emergency fire telephones are equipped with two-way communication capabilities, allowing emergency services to provide instructions or information to occupants during an emergency. This can be especially useful in situations where evacuation routes are blocked or when occupants need to shelter in place until help arrives.

Emergency fire telephones can also play a crucial role in assisting individuals with disabilities during a fire emergency. People with mobility issues, hearing impairments, or other disabilities may have difficulty using traditional means of communication during a fire emergency. Emergency fire telephones are equipped with features such as a large, easy-to-read keypad and a visual alert system to make them accessible to individuals with disabilities. This ensures that everyone in the building, regardless of their abilities, can quickly and effectively communicate with emergency services during a fire emergency.
